 Introduction and Background

The study had to be prepared in the backdrop of revival or reforms that took place in the education system, recruitment strategies, employment opportunities and a striking improvement in the workplace environment globally. Australia was not left behind in the reformation that was taking place that had started in the early decade if 2000 (Sahlberg 2010).

The Lisbon Strategy as discussed by Sahlberg (Sahlberg 2010) states about a striking reformation that took place in Europe in late 90’s. ‘Education and Training 2010’ has been the adoption of a single comprehensive strategy for education and training in Europe. The Lisbon Strategy has been implemented through a common Work program and its 3 generic goals and 13 specific objectives of education and training systems.

An efficient education system of imparting quality education both at secondary and higher education level will ensure that a deserving pool of skilled manpower gets into the competitive world thus throwing stiff opposition to the competition globally.

1. Education

Education is the most elementary part in the growth process of an individual; this has been marred by the usage of conventional techniques in imparting the education (Michael 2009)

ü  The prominent demerit of a traditional classroom teaching method is that the instructor is not able to give one-on-one attention to all the students present and listening.

ü  Another drawback is the single instructor’s inability to have command on all the leaning styles which is unique to every student; this would hamper the overall learning curve of an individual.

ü  Administrative woes serve as an impediment in conducting the affairs of lecture hall or a classroom

ü  Some students do not adjust to the classroom environment and thus special attention is needed to address the issue, this cannot be addressed with huge student population in the class

3. Workplace Environment

There are lot implications of an individual’s outlook to work life balance on the basis of workplace environment provided by the employer (Manage Employee Problems at Work 2007). The most important thing is to maintain the safety and security standards intact and by doing so the organizations can improve conditions of working and productivity (Emerging Technologies for Workplace Safety 2012). They can be discussed as:

3.1 Job Design Technology

This essentially means the most specific suited needs of the a particular industry for e.g. a bank needs specific training modules and customized software to meet the intricate requirements of the banking industry hence do not use general database ware.

3.2 Computerized Controls

This area is specifically targeted towards reducing the manual labor and making the flow of information more centralized and controlled through limited channels. Time sheet entries, attendance marking interface and work performance tracking sheets are a few examples of this.

3.3 Training and Educational Programs
